Transaction 07536526a88bcc78945581a59b1011126a8bf028ee3bb9c00a7d51c4e763b36e

1 Input
2 Outputs
  • 07536526a88bcc78945581a59b1011126a8bf028ee3bb9c00a7d51c4e763b36e:0
  • value  10846010
    address  33bJCjqhtZxshGuTHXbEGG23EvM17iTHe5
  • 07536526a88bcc78945581a59b1011126a8bf028ee3bb9c00a7d51c4e763b36e:1
  • value  91351
    address  3FWXDkyAS5MMSjkctZbpB9s7T1QH1PFTAG